Conservation Efforts for Ocellated Turkeys in the Yucatan Peninsula

The Yucatecan turkey, a colorful bird native to the lush forests of the Yucatan Peninsula, is facing increasing threats to its existence. Logging practices are significant contributors to this decline.

To guarantee the future of these magnificent creatures, a range of initiatives are being implemented.

Important strategy is the establishment of protected areas where the birds can thrive undisturbed. Additionally, efforts are underway to educate local communities about the importance of turkey conservation. This includes promoting responsible land use practices that minimize destruction.
